Output 3d8fb42c182c33c93257e9b88a6823017a3455cdeeb88618cd35fff9f4c03b40:0

value
176592
script pubkey
OP_0 OP_PUSHBYTES_20 89604be3b88a2edc436ad2a164068cd5090cc22c
address
bc1q39syhcac3ghdcsm262skgp5v65yses3vw92efd
transaction
3d8fb42c182c33c93257e9b88a6823017a3455cdeeb88618cd35fff9f4c03b40